We are recruiting an Estimating Manager to join a growing construction business, a truly exciting opportunity for an experienced Estimating Manager to take the lead in shaping our estimating function. As our business expands, as the Estimating Manager you will manage a team of six Estimators, overseeing tenders for new build and refurbishment projects across the public sector, with values from £100k to £10m.
What You will Do:
- Lead, mentor, and develop a team of six Estimators.
- Prepare and review tenders and cost plans, ensuring bids are accurate, competitive, and commercially sound.
- Work closely with clients, consultants, and internal teams to deliver high quality submissions.
- Drive improvements in estimating processes and team performance.
- Report directly to senior management and influence strategy for the estimating department.
About You:
- Proven track record as an Estimating Manager or Senior Estimator in construction.
- Strong experience in new build and refurbishment projects.
- Public sector experience is essential.
- Excellent leadership, communication, and organisational skills.
- Comfortable managing multiple tenders and meeting tight deadlines.
What We Offer:
- Competitive salary.
- 3% pension contribution.
- Step into a new Estimating Manager role created as the business grows, a chance to shape and lead a department.
- Office based position with long term career progression.
